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: The following and other duties may be assigned as necessary:
Media trafficking and maintaining placements, rotation of ads, and creative throughout the lifetime of campaigns
In-house expert on Third-Party Ad Servers (CampaignManager360), Rich Media, DCO, and Viewability/Fraud
Optimize campaign performance through continuous monitoring, to maintain KPIs, conduct A/B testing, and perform data analysis
Media expert in managing SEM, Programmatic and paid social media
Efficiently distribute tags, trackers, and creative assets to all media partners
Embed audience measurement, verification, and other tracking components for external vendors as needed
Support daily QA and timely troubleshooting of all placements, tagging, and floodlights/vendor pixels for on-site tracking implementations to ensure proper tracking
Proven experience in working within media buying software, trafficking, and generating performance reports
Ability to create media campaign pitch decks and present to executive stakeholders
Conduct thorough market research and competitive analysis to identify key trends, opportunities, and consumer insights to inform media planning decisions
Work closely with internal marketing teams and external media agencies to plan, negotiate, and execute media buys across various traditional and digital channels
Facilitate the development of integrated media campaigns and analyze media performance metrics to track campaign effectiveness and optimize strategies for maximum impact and ROI
Oversee the creative process for advertising collateral, ensuring alignment with strategic objectives and brand guidelines
Manage media budgets and allocations, ensuring efficient use of resources and adherence to financial guidelines
Cultivate and maintain strong relationships with media vendors and partners, evaluating media plans, negotiating favorable terms and maximizing value for the resort
Stay updated on the latest paid media trends and technologies, customer research, market conditions, industry vertical trends, and competitor data to identify new opportunities to improve campaign performance
Ensure that deliverables created are high quality, impactful, and in line with Fontainebleau Las Vegas' best practices and methodologies
Assist in coordinating and executing billing activities to ensure accurate and timely invoice processing
